Hans Musgrave
Hans Musgrave
The problem seems to be the recursive reference to the `@Frame(...)` type. As a partial workaround for now, you can use `@asyncCall` in enough places to break any `@Frame`-type cycles...
> @ianwilliamson do you have a use case for eig derivatives? Would be useful to know a bit about it. Just in case this is helpful, I've never actually had...
> However, this gauge is usually not important for the calculation of interested quantities (expectation values) because it gets multiplied out This is my experience as well. I've only ever...
> Instead, we need higher level auto-diff primitives, corresponding to well defined functions that are invariant of gauge. That makes sense. Do you think it's still reasonable to support eigenvalue...